Keh Doon Tumhein

Shall I Tell You) is an Indian Hindi-language mystery thriller television series that aired from 4 September 2023 to 19 November 2023 on StarPlus.

It is produced by Shweta Shinde under Vajra Production and it stars Mudit Nayar and Yukti Kapoor.
